Web5 aug. 2024 · The Cape Buffalo is a herd animal and has a stable composition, which changes only in cases of deaths and births. On average, a Cape buffalo herd can comprise 350 members, but it may grow as large as 5,000 strong! Large herds tend to break up during seasons with dry weather and regroup in the rainy season.
